Ann Arbor firefighters rescue pets from house fire

Ann Arbor firefighters rescued two dogs and four other small pets from a house fire this afternoon on the city's northside.

No one was home at the time of the fire, and there were no reported injuries.


Neighbors reported seeing smoke coming from the roof of the residence in the 800 block of Larkspur Street. Fire crews made a hole in the roof for the smoke to escape so that they could work on the fire, according to Battalion Chief Kevin Cook.

At this time, the blaze appears to have started in the bedroom, although the cause is still under investigation, said Cook.
